- RUSA & Partisan politics
- The board recently received some inquiries about the extent to which RUSA or RUSA Regions should allow such conversations to take place on RUSA and RUSA Region-moderated social media. The concern extends to event naming and identifying with causes. Any such identification runs the risk of making RUSA less welcoming.
- RUSA is also bound by the rules of 501(c)(3) which set restrictions on political involvement
- The board will discuss guidelines for how much or little RUSA will moderate such activity within its sphere of control and influence.
- Charlie presented the Web team report
- Earlier in the year the Web Team sent out a survey for feedback on the website, this resulted in a number of responses centering on usability and navigation of the website. The Web Team reached out to those respondents to see if they would like to join a task force to create more concrete guidance that the Web Team could act on.
- This task force met earlier in the week and compiled a list of concrete suggestions that could be prioritized and acted upon. Examples include simplifying the site navigation and collecting and keeping current the linked media.
- This task force will continue to recruit volunteers and meet again next month.
- Membership workflows have received a lot of updates to ensure ease of membership renewal and a reduction of duplicate or erroneous membership signups, which should reduce the burden on volunteers managing these requests
- The Web Team continues to work with Ted Fey to manage the parts of the site indexed by Google. The Web Team will also work to manage how the RUSA site appears on the Google Search Results Page.
- A number of usability suggestions were shared after last year’s Philadelphia Bike Expo, the Web Team will work to integrate some of these before the upcoming Philadelphia Bike Expo.
- It was also discussed whether American Randonneur should be posted as a PDF to the website sooner after the print edition is published, this topic will be discussed over email and presented at the next board meeting.

- Dave presented on Climbing and team ride requirements
- Dave has had a long discussion with Ride with GPS about their elevation calculations that needs to be collated and shared with the board
- Dave has received a number of responses from RBAs about how they collect routes from team events. Based on these responses he recommends that no changes be made to the Team event rules. In most cases this should result in all teams receiving accurate climbing credit, though potentially some more information about this could be added to the rules or messaged to RBAs.
- Dawn presented on the difficulty of moderating Facebook
- Many posts to the RUSA Facebook have been stuck in moderation for seemingly no reason. This has caused frustration from a number of active members who don’t understand why their posts are not appearing.
- The board is not aware of any automated way to fix this or a Facebook setting that would ease this issue and will instead pursue finding more moderating volunteers for the Facebook Club page to better unblock posts.
- Dawn is working on adding a few members to both Instagram and Facebook to mitigate this and increase monitoring the Facebook group on a more consistent basis.
